What companies run services between Governador Valadares, Brazil and Porto Seguro, Brazil?

Azul flies from Coronel Altino Machado De Oliveira Airport (GVR) to Porto Seguro (BPS) once daily. Alternatively, Gontijo operates a bus from Governador Valadares to Porto Seguro every 3 hours. Tickets cost R$230–750 and the journey takes 12h 28m. Two other operators also service this route.
